Sans Normal Abgug 9 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A smooth, oblique sans with rounded, continuous curves and soft terminals. Strokes are evenly weighted with minimal contrast, producing a consistent texture in text. Letterforms lean noticeably forward, with generous apertures and open counters that keep shapes legible. The uppercase is simple and geometric-leaning, while the lowercase introduces more humanist movement—most evident in the single-storey a and g and the relaxed, flowing joins. Numerals follow the same rounded construction, with clear, uncomplicated shapes suited to running text and UI-like contexts.

Well suited to contemporary branding and marketing where a forward-leaning, energetic tone is desired. It can work for short editorial passages, headlines, and subheads that benefit from an italic voice throughout, and it remains readable enough for UI labels or product copy when set with comfortable spacing.

The overall tone is contemporary and approachable, with a sense of motion from the steady slant. Rounded shapes and open forms give it a friendly, informal voice, while the clean construction keeps it neutral enough for general-purpose communication.

This design appears intended as a clean, everyday sans in a permanent oblique style—balancing geometric simplicity with a warmer, more human rhythm. The goal seems to be an italic that feels natural and primary, offering motion and friendliness without relying on high contrast or calligraphic detailing.

In the sample text, the italic rhythm stays even across long lines, and the round forms (C, G, O, Q) read smoothly without sharp interruptions. The forward-leaning stance and soft corners create a cohesive, streamlined feel that works best when the obliqueness is treated as a core personality rather than an occasional emphasis.
